Simon is a highly qualified and registered Patent and Trade Mark Attorney in both Australia and New Zealand with a strong technical foundation in engineering and over twenty years experience in intellectual property law. With a Bachelor of Engineering (Joint Honours) in Electrical and Mechanical Engineering from the University of Strathclyde and a Master of Intellectual Property Law from the University of Melbourne, Simon brings a unique blend of technical insight and legal proficiency to the practice.

Throughout his career, Simon has worked with a diverse range of clients- from startups to established companies-helping them protect their innovations and navigate complex IP landscapes. Simon spent a period of time seconded as an in-house IP counsel for a major gaming company and also took a brief time-out from his attorney role to work as a patent examiner at IP Australia. Simon specializes in patent and trade mark filings, IP strategy, and providing legal counsel for IP disputes. Simon’s aim is to help clients achieve strong and enforceable IP portfolios that align with their business objectives.
